    Turkish Airlines World Golf Cup excitement continues

    Amateur golfers from around the world are coming to compete at the annual Turkish Airlines World Golf Cup for another challenging but enjoyable tournament. The tournament winners and Grand Final competitors will play with world’s top golf professionals at the Turkish Airlines Open in Antalya, from November 7-10.

    Turkish Airlines World Golf Cup, which started in Bahrain this February, will continue at more than 100 cities in 71 countries. Hosted at the fabulous golf courses of Istanbul, New York, Stockholm, London, Berlin and Mauritius.

    During the Turkish Airlines World Golf Cup, thousands of participants gather to play in many different countries and golf courses in an attempt to execute the perfect birdie shot to win one of the world’s most famous qualifying matches. Participants that win over 100 games will take part in the Grand Final in Türkiye at the start of November. The top finishers in the final get to play the world’s top professionals at the Turkish Airlines Open from November 7-10. The English golfer, Justin Rose, is the reigning Turkish Airlines Open champion, two years in a row. Last year’s victory in this high-profile tournament, raised Rose’s world ranking to first place.

    Only guests from Africa, Asia, North and South America, Europe and the Middle East are participating in the Turkish Airlines World Golf Cup, not only a golf tournament, but a global network meeting. The events bring together important customers of Turkish Airlines, other sponsors and the leading names of the travel industry. Throughout the tournament, guests play golf and network on the world’s most high-profile golf courses.

    The Turkish Airlines World Golf Cup, started in 2013 with 12 events organized in 12 countries. Today, it is the world’s largest and most comprehensive corporate amateur golf series with over 8 thousand participants.
